SPORTS RELIEF 2010
On Friday 19th March we joined thousands of schools in Britain and raised money for Sports Relief. Pupils paid £1 to wear sports gear or to dress up as their favourite sports star and took part in a range of different sports throughout the day. We had planned for every pupil to run a sports relief mile around the school but due to the rain we were unable to do this. Instead, pupils took part in an obstacle course in the Sports Hall and played handball in the old hall. In the afternoon, Key Stage 2 took part in penalty shoot-outs, basketball shooting, badminton and cricket whilst Key Stage 3 played Dodgeball. In Key Stage 4 there was a football match between Year 10 and Year 11 on the field in terrible conditions. Pupils really enjoyed the match in the rain and the final score was 4 - 4. There will be a re-match in the summer term.
In addition to this, Miss Lavery did a sponsored walk to school from her home in Kingskerswell. She raised £300.
The total raised for Sport Relief by Combe Pafford School was £500.
